What Is Blackplum (Jamun)?
Blackplum — also known as Kala Jamun — is a seasonal fruit traditionally used in Ayurveda for supporting sugar metabolism.
The seeds of Jamun (Jamun Beej) are particularly valued because they contain active compounds like jamboline and jambosine, which help regulate glucose absorption in the body.
Due to its strong therapeutic profile, Jamun is commonly used in Ayurvedic formulations for diabetes management, digestive balance, urinary health, and overall metabolic support.
What Makes Jamun Effective for Diabetes?
Jamun is not just a sweet-tangy fruit; its seeds are a potent ingredient in Ayurvedic medicine. Both the pulp and seeds contain natural compounds that help the body utilize glucose better, making it a valuable fruit for managing diabetes mellitus.
1. Jamun Improves Insulin Sensitivity
One of the most important reasons Jamun is recommended for diabetes is its ability to enhance insulin activity.

Jamun seeds contain two bioactive compounds—jamboline and jambosine. These compounds help the body:
-
Use insulin more effectively
-
Slow down the conversion of carbohydrates into glucose
-
Reduce sudden sugar spikes after meals
Why this matters:
In type 2 diabetes, the body stops responding properly to insulin. When Jamun enhances insulin sensitivity, the sugar present in the blood is absorbed into the cells more efficiently. Over time, this supports better sugar control and reduces the load on the pancreas.

4. High Fiber Content Slows Glucose Absorption
Jamun contains a good amount of dietary fiber, which plays a major role in managing blood sugar.
Fiber slows down digestion, meaning glucose is released into the bloodstream gradually instead of all at once.

Benefits of slow glucose release:
-
Prevents sudden increases in blood sugar
-
Helps maintain energy throughout the day
-
Reduces hunger and cravings
-
Supports weight loss, which is essential for many diabetic patients
This is why Jamun is considered one of the most suitable fruits for diabetic patients, especially when taken in seed powder or capsule form.

How Jamun Helps Control Diabetes Naturally

Jamun supports the body in various biological processes that influence blood sugar. Here’s how:
• It improves glucose metabolism
The nutrients in Jamun help break down glucose in the body more effectively, reducing the amount of sugar that remains in the blood.
• It prevents sudden sugar spikes
Jamboline in the seeds slows the conversion of starch to sugar, supporting smoother sugar levels after eating.
• It supports pancreatic health
Antioxidants in Jamun protect the pancreas and help maintain its functioning—important for insulin production.
• It helps reduce cravings and overeating
The astringent taste of Jamun helps reduce excessive hunger, which is a common issue in diabetes.
• It supports liver function
A healthy liver is essential for glucose balance, and Jamun naturally supports liver detoxification and metabolism.
Each of these actions helps make Jamun a holistic and natural supporter in diabetes management.
